Abstract
A screw cutting tool for cutting a screw comprising a first grip having a first cutting aperture, a second grip pivotally connected to the first grip, the second grip having a second cutting aperture, a measuring scale attached to a proximal end of the first or second grip, and a screw holder slidably attached to the measuring scale having a hole extending therethrough, wherein the hole aligns with the first and second cutting apertures in at least one position.
